What is L-Carnitine?

L-carnitine is a naturally occurring compound derived from the amino acids lysine and methionine. It plays a crucial role in the body's energy production by shuttling long-chain fatty acids into the mitochondria, the "powerhouses" of cells, to be burned for fuel. Your body produces its own L-carnitine, but you also get small amounts from food, primarily red meat and dairy. For most healthy individuals, the body's natural production and dietary intake are sufficient. However, supplements are popular for those seeking to boost their levels, particularly for goals related to fat loss and exercise performance.

The Mixed Evidence for Weight Loss

For many, the primary appeal of L-carnitine is its supposed fat-burning power. The logic is simple: if it transports more fat into your cells to be used for energy, you’ll burn more fat and lose weight. However, research findings on this topic are inconsistent and often show only modest effects.

Studies Supporting Weight Loss

  • A 2020 meta-analysis of 37 studies found that L-carnitine supplementation led to a modest but significant reduction in body weight, body mass index (BMI), and fat mass in overweight and obese adults.
  • A separate 2021 review involving people with type 2 diabetes found that 2g of daily L-carnitine promoted weight loss.

Limitations and Conflicting Results

  • Many studies show no significant weight loss effect, particularly in healthy, active individuals.
  • The effect is often dependent on combining the supplement with a proper diet and regular exercise, suggesting it is a supportive tool, not a primary driver of fat loss.
  • A 2016 systematic review found that participants taking L-carnitine lost an average of 1.33 kg more than the placebo group, though larger studies are needed.
  • Importantly, the effectiveness may depend on your initial carnitine levels. Vegans and vegetarians, for example, have lower dietary intake and may see more noticeable changes from supplementation.

Impact on Athletic Performance and Recovery

For athletes, the effects of L-carnitine extend beyond simple fat burning. Evidence suggests it may offer more benefits in the realm of recovery than immediate performance enhancement.

Performance and Recovery Benefits

  • Improved Recovery: Studies show L-carnitine can reduce muscle damage and soreness from strenuous exercise, potentially through its antioxidant and anti-inflammatory properties.
  • Increased Oxygen Supply: Some research suggests it can improve muscle oxygen supply, which could boost endurance.
  • Enhanced Blood Flow: L-carnitine can increase nitric oxide production, which enhances blood flow to muscles and may improve pumps and nutrient delivery during workouts.

Mixed Performance Results

  • While some studies show benefits for endurance and power, others found no significant effect on moderate-intensity exercise performance.
  • The effects are often delayed, taking weeks or months to build up, unlike fast-acting supplements such as creatine or caffeine.

Comparison of L-Carnitine Forms

L-carnitine is available in several forms, each with unique properties and best uses. Choosing the right one depends on your specific goals.

Form of L-Carnitine Primary Use Case Typical Daily Dosage Key Features
L-Carnitine L-Tartrate (LCLT) Exercise performance and recovery 1,000–4,000 mg Fast absorption, ideal for athletes
Acetyl-L-Carnitine (ALCAR) Brain health and cognitive function 500–3,000 mg Crosses the blood-brain barrier easily
Propionyl-L-Carnitine (PL-carnitine) Heart health and blood flow 1,000–4,000 mg May improve circulation, less common for weight loss

Important Considerations and Potential Side Effects

While generally considered safe for most people at standard dosages, L-carnitine is not without potential downsides. Always consult a healthcare professional before beginning supplementation.

Potential Side Effects

  • Digestive Issues: Mild side effects can include stomach upset, cramps, nausea, vomiting, or diarrhea.
  • "Fishy" Odor: High doses can cause a distinct, fishy body odor.
  • TMAO Levels: Some studies suggest that L-carnitine supplementation can increase blood levels of trimethylamine-N-oxide (TMAO), a compound linked to an increased risk of heart disease. This risk seems to be higher in meat-eaters than in vegans.
  • Drug Interactions: It may interact with certain medications, including blood-thinners and thyroid hormone.

Dosage and Timing

For maximum effectiveness, especially for athletic performance, research suggests taking L-carnitine with carbohydrates to promote insulin production, which helps transport carnitine into muscle cells. Timing can vary based on goals, but taking it 30-60 minutes before a workout is a common recommendation.

Conclusion: Setting Realistic Expectations

So, do L-carnitine supplements actually work? The answer is nuanced. For most healthy, active people, the effects on fat loss are modest and primarily observed when combined with regular exercise. For exercise recovery and endurance, the benefits are more consistent and well-documented. Certain populations, such as vegans, vegetarians, and those with specific medical conditions like kidney disease, may experience more profound benefits due to low baseline carnitine levels. It's not a magic pill, but a tool that can provide a slight edge when integrated into a healthy lifestyle.
